Natural Gas Prices in Barnett, MO
Residential Natural Gas Rates in Barnett
Residential natural gas prices in Barnett in March 2026 averaged 15.74 dollars per thousand cubic feet ($/Mcf), which was approximately INF% more than the national average rate of $/Mcf (March 2026). [2]

On a year-over-year basis, residential natural gas prices in Barnett (Missouri) increased approximately 20%, from 11.82 $/Mcf (February 2025) to 14.24 $/Mcf (February 2026). [2]
